What is the legal basis for this?

The primary legal basis for processing your personal data within the context of this application process is Section 26 of the version of the German Data Protection Act (Bundesdatenschutzgesetz, BDSG) that was in force as of 25 May 2018. In accordance with this, data processing is permitted if it is necessary in order to make decisions on whether to enter into an employment contract.

If the data is required in order to take any legal action once the application process is complete, it can be processed subject to the conditions laid down in Article 6 GDPR, particularly for the purposes of legitimate interests in accordance with point (f) of Article 6(1) GDPR. Our interest would then lie in the establishment or defence of claims.

How long the data stored for?

If an application is rejected, the applicant’s data is erased after six months.

If you have given your consent for your personal data to be stored for longer, we will transfer your data to our applicant pool. The data there is erased after two years.

If you are offered a job during the application process, your data will be carried over from the applicant data system to our personnel information system.

To which recipients is the data transferred?

Once we receive your application, our HR department reviews your applicant data. Suitable applications are then forwarded internally to the manager of the department with the relevant job vacancy. The next steps are then arranged. In principle, the only people within our company who have access to your data are those who need it in order to carry out our application process properly.

Where is the data processed?

The data is processed exclusively in data centers in the Federal Republic of Germany.
